
Researchers from the Dance Science Department
have compiled a comprehensive review of previous research
undertaken in the dance and health fields, relating to the impact
of various kinds of dance, on elderly populations. Commissioned by
the Thames Gateway Dance Partnerships, this study aimed to provide
a broad overview of the field, indicating where research has been
carried out already, and also highlighting areas for further
research.
This review proves a valuable tool in
surveying the body of existing research, and advocating for much
needed further research within the areas of dance and health for
older populations.
